* Chairman of the Nigeria Union of Journalists Anambra State Council, Dr. Odogwu Emeka Odogwu, has stated without equivocations that the government of Professor Chukwuma Soludo does not partner journalists in the state.
Odogwu who made this statement at a one-day conference tagged” Investigative Journalism: Leadership, Accountability And Stewardship For Sustainable Development ” held at the Godwin Ezeemo International Press Centre Awka, said there was need for the present administration to carry journalists along to enable them report accurately government policies, programmes and projects.

* All is set as twenty two teams are ready to take part in the first ‘Ife Igbo’ peace football competition in Awka, the Anambra capital. ANN gathered that the opening game will kickoff at the Awka Township Stadium while the group games will take place at Ayom na Okpala and All Saints Anglican Church football fields. Managing Director of Awka Capital Territory Development Authority, Mr Osita Onuko, sponsor of the competition said the football fiesta was meant to foster unity and engender peace among Awka villages.
* Assistant Inspector-General (AIG) of Police, AIG Godwin Ndidi Aghaulor, has assumed duty at Zone thirteen, Ukpo, comprising Anambra and Enugu State respectively. ANN reports that Aghaulor succeeded AIG Tony Olofu, sequel to his retirement from active service. At the commands headquaters in Ukpo, Dunukofia local government area of Anambra state, Aghaulor was received by top police officers in the command.
